Tomorrow I declare my keepers, no position, everybody starts the same after keepers, std league no PPR. My choices are Lynch, A Foster and Jordy Nelson. I am leaning towards Lynch and Nelson, just don't trust Foster anymore. What do you think?

Tomorrow I declare my keepers, no position, everybody starts the same after keepers, std league no PPR. My choices are Lynch, A Foster and Jordy Nelson. I am leaning towards Lynch and Nelson, just don't trust Foster anymore. What do you think?

 

 

That is tougher for me that some because for some reason I think Foster is gonna suprise everyone and have a good year.

 

For me Lynch is a certainty which leaves Nelson ( who wll be the consenses pick) and Foster.

 

I would go Lynch and Foster myself. probably half the teams are gonna keep 2 backs which means RB's are gonna be a slim pickens right from the start. Foster could be 1 of the 1st picks. plus, as many good WR's as there is this year w,hile the guys that don't keep 2 backs are reaching for RB's there will be nice WR's for you to grab.
